Article Overview

Laser diodes are classified into various types based on their structure, mode of operation, and applications, including single-mode, multi-mode, VCSELs, and more.

Common Types of Laser Diodes

  1. Single-Mode Laser Diodes:

    • These diodes support only one optical mode, resulting in a highly focused beam with low divergence and high coherence. They are typically used in applications requiring precision, such as fiber optic communication and sensing .
  2. Multi-Mode Laser Diodes:

    • These have a broader active region that supports multiple optical modes, producing a wider beam with high divergence. They are used in applications that require high intensity, such as laser cutting and printing .
  3. Vertical-Cavity Surface-Emitting Lasers (VCSELs):

    • VCSELs emit light perpendicular to the surface of the device. They are known for their compact size and efficiency, making them suitable for applications like optical data communication and sensing .
  4. Edge-Emitting Laser Diodes:

    • These emit light from the edge of the semiconductor chip and are commonly used in telecommunications, optical data storage, and laser printing. They can provide high optical power levels and efficiency .
  5. Master Oscillator Power Amplifier (MOPA) Laser Diodes:

    • This type combines a single-mode laser diode as an oscillator with a multi-mode laser diode as an amplifier, allowing for high output power without compromising spectral width. They are used in applications like LIDAR and medical imaging .
  6. Quantum Dot Laser Diodes:

    • These utilize quantum dots as the active medium, offering advantages like lower threshold currents and improved temperature stability. They are used in advanced communication systems and high-performance lasers .
